Episode 31 - Navigating BankTech through a VC Lens with Matthew Kelley (FINTOP Network)
In this episode of the Treasury Whisperer's TalkCast Podcast, host Seth Marlowe is joined by Matthew Kelley, Director of FINTOP Network (www.fintopcapital.com/network). They discuss the evolving landscape of banking and fintech. Matt shares insights on the role of compliance in fintech investments, the impact of COVID on banking innovation, and the importance of AI and automation in reducing banking expenses. Matt also highlights the role of credit unions in fintech, emerging trends in embedded finance, and the misconceptions that both fintech founders and banks have about working together.

Matt Kelley is a seasoned banking and fintech strategist serving as Director of the FINTOP Network, where he leads engagement with banks and fintech innovators to accelerate technology adoption and partnerships across a national network of financial institutions. In this role within the FINTOP ecosystem he manages programming, cultivates strategic relationships, and supports investments that help banks modernize and compete in an evolving digital landscape. Matt brings more than two decades of experience in institutional equities and financial services, including senior roles at Stephens, Piper Jaffray, Sterne Agee (Stifel), Moors & Cabot, and RBC Capital Markets, and holds a Bachelor of Science from Marquette University
